1990 Lancia Dedra vs. 1994 Volvo 480

To start off, 1994 Volvo 480 is newer by 4 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1990 Lancia Dedra.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1990 Lancia Dedra would be higher. At 1,995 cc (4 cylinders), 1990 Lancia Dedra is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1990 Lancia Dedra (111 HP @ 5750 RPM) has 3 more horse power than 1994 Volvo 480. (108 HP @ 5800 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1990 Lancia Dedra should accelerate faster than 1994 Volvo 480.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1990 Lancia Dedra weights approximately 210 kg more than 1994 Volvo 480.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1990 Lancia Dedra (157 Nm @ 3300 RPM) has 14 more torque (in Nm) than 1994 Volvo 480. (143 Nm @ 4000 RPM). This means 1990 Lancia Dedra will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1994 Volvo 480. 1990 Lancia Dedra has automatic transmission and 1994 Volvo 480 has manual transmission. 1994 Volvo 480 will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 1990 Lancia Dedra will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
